“Star Wars: Fate of the Fallen” was crafted through a collaborative, AI-enhanced workflow. Dustin began by conceptualizing the narrative and world-building. RunwayML facilitated much of the post-production, automating animations and editing processes, while Eleven Labs contributed to voice cloning. CGI elements were modeled in Cinema4D, blending classic 3D animation with AI-powered techniques for a polished result. The use of sound libraries like Artlist.io ensured a professional-grade audio experience. By intertwining traditional and cutting-edge tools, this project exemplifies the new possibilities emerging in NeoCinema.

Description of Result
“Star Wars: Fate of the Fallen” is a fan-made film that merges traditional filmmaking techniques with cutting-edge AI and CGI technologies. At 26 minutes and counting, this film blends AI-generated content, such as voice synthesis and visual effects, with more traditional approaches like 3D modeling in Cinema4D. The preview is intended to demonstrate the film’s groundbreaking use of AI to enhance narrative storytelling within the Star Wars universe, while also showcasing the evolving capabilities of NeoCinema.
Step-by-Step Breakdown
-
Pre-Production:
- Scriptwriting and Conceptualization: The storyline for “Fate of the Fallen” was written by Dustin Hollywood, taking inspiration from the Star Wars universe. In the conceptual phase, they likely considered how AI could enhance certain aspects of the production.
-
Character Development:
- RunwayML was used to help animate characters, and Eleven Labs was employed to clone character voices for dialogues, ensuring accurate sound while reducing the need for live actors.
-
VFX Creation:
- Cinema4D was used to design 3D models and create the film’s CGI environments. Hailuo AI and Kling AI supported the generation of visual effects for complex scenes, like space battles or detailed character animations.
-
Editing and Compositing:
- Adobe After Effects and Adobe Video were used to assemble the scenes, apply filters, and create seamless transitions. RunwayML contributed to automating some of the editing tasks and enhanced the overall production workflow.
-
Sound Design:
- Dustin and sound creators sourced music and sound effects from Artlist.io, while blending them with custom designs to give the film its immersive audio experience.
-
Final Review and Export:
- The final film was rendered after reviewing all CGI scenes and audio tracks. RunwayML helped streamline the post-production, combining the elements into a coherent cinematic experience.
